wulfbindewald Posted May 28, 2015 Share Posted May 28, 2015 Hi there, enclosed a pic to demonstrate the bleeding through the FTX Queenstown airport. What I did so far: - Scenery loaded in Oceania and swapped to default and back to Oceania - Checked scenery/world/scenery and found 60 .bgl files (none .off) e.g. ADE_FTX_NZSI_NZQN_elevation_adjustment.BGL. - latest ORBX Library 150331 applied - FTXC2 confirms version and region - Crosschecked 2 further airports in this region in Dunedin and Christchurch, but everything looks normal here Wulf P.S. afterwards I applied the new airport NZQN_105 Queenstown scenery and everything looks fine. Adam Banks Posted May 28, 2015 Share Posted May 28, 2015 Aaah ... OK ... I get it now!! So this is with NZQN deactivated. How did you deactivate it - just un-ticking it in scenery library? I don't think it's quite as simple as that (once you've installed the NZQN add-on). A couple of those 60 bgl files you mention in your first post will probably have to be manually set to off, as I suspect FTX Central can only enable/disable complete areas. Adam Banks Posted May 29, 2015 Share Posted May 29, 2015 @Holger : I de-activated my NZQN add-on and got exactly the same as Wulf's pic. This was without manually disabling any bgls. I don't have any other scenery other than ORBX active on my system (nor anything that introduces any scenery-related files). For NZ, I have NZNI, NZSI, NZQN and NZMF. It looks like NZSI on its own may be isn't deactivating default FSX/P3D objects at NZQN <??>. It's academic for me - as the full NZQN works fine, but I wonder what plain NZSI users might be seeing? Holger Sandmann Posted May 31, 2015 Share Posted May 31, 2015 Hi guys, I can confirm the issue. Looks like perhaps a wrong source file was used when we made the NZSI airport files compatible with P3Dv2. I'll get in touch with the developer.
